Always one of the first places I visit when in Saariselka. Attractive little modern wooden church in the village with astounding views from the full length windows behind the altar of the adjacent forest, its like bringing nature inside. Stunning by day and by night when the trees are floodlit . A very peaceful, tranquil and thought provoking place to sit and contemplate for a while.
Apart from church services the church is used for community events and the New year concert of traditional Finnish songs was well worth attending, very atmospheric and a glimpse into the local culture so do attend an event too if there is one scheduled.
